54 BELOW, Broadway's Supper Club, presents The Cast of SIDE SHOW Reunites in "ADDED ATTRACTIONS" on Monday, March 9. Actors and musicians from the recent Broadway revival of SIDE SHOW come back together to perform some favorites from the show, songs cut or never used and new arrangements of some familiar numbers.

Featuring Erin Davie, Emily Padgett, Ryan Silverman, Matthew Hydzik, David St. Louis and ensemble members Charity Angel Dawson, Lauren Elder, Javier Ignacio, Barrett Martin, Kelvin Moon Loh, Con O'Shea-Creal, Blair Ross, Hannah Shankman and Josh Walker, the evening will feature a special appearance by SIDE SHOW composer Henry Krieger and will be hosted by book and lyrics author Bill Russell. Musical Direction is by Greg Jarrett with Larry Lelli on drums and Ray Kilday on bass.

The Cast of SIDE SHOW Reunites in "ADDED ATTRACTIONS" plays 54 Below (254 West 54th Street) on Monday, March, 9th at 7:00 and 9:30 p.m. There is a $45-110 cover charge and $25 food and beverage minimum. Tickets and information are available at www.54Below.com. Tickets on the day of performance after 4:00 are only available by calling (646) 476-3551.

The cast of the acclaimed 2014 revival of SIDE SHOW, book and lyrics by Bill Russell, music by Henry Krieger, is pleased to reunite for these special concerts. Many of them were with the show from the production's genesis at the La Jolla Playhouse in the fall of 2013, through the Kennedy Center in Washington, DC last summer and then at the St. James Theater on Broadway. In collaboration with Academy Award winning director Bill Condon, the authors rethought and reworked the show's original version which played at the Richard Rodgers Theater in 1997.
